FAQs of Oil Seal Bearing:


Q: How does the oil seal bearing provide enhanced corrosion resistance in industrial applications?

A: The bearings design integrates double rubber seals combined with an oil seal structure, effectively blocking water, dust, and aggressive chemicals. This prevents corrosion on the chrome steel surfaces, ensuring reliable performance in environments prone to contaminants.

Q: What benefits does the deep groove and single-row structure offer for automotive and machinery use?

A: The deep groove design enables efficient handling of both radial and axial loads, while the single-row structure ensures stable rotation and simplified installation. This makes it suitable for automotive, industrial, and agricultural equipment requiring consistent and robust load support.

Q: Where can this oil seal bearing be used, given its temperature and speed specifications?

A: With a temperature range of -20C to +120C and a limiting speed of 10,000 RPM, this bearing suits high-speed electric motors, automotive wheels, and heavy-duty machinery that encounter varying thermal and operational conditions.

Q: When should maintenance be performed on these bearings?

A: Thanks to the sealed, grease-lubricated design, maintenance intervals are typically extended. Periodic checks for seal integrity and lubrication sufficiency are advised, particularly after extended use or operation in harsh environments.

Q: What is the typical installation process for this type of bearing?

A: Installation usually involves cleaning the housing and shaft, pressing the bearing into place without applying force to the seals, and ensuring alignment. The robust steel cage and double seals facilitate quick and secure installation.
